Question 321167: Simplify by removing factors of 1. 4z-12/3-z The simplified form is?
Answer by stanbon(75887)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Simplify by removing factors of 1.
--------------------------
4z-12/3-z The simplified form is?
---
Factor to get:
[-4(3-z)]/[3-z]
---
= -4
